## Runbook: Spreadsheet Export Memory Spikes (Ledgerly)

When a customer reports a failed export, check whether the sheet exceeds 200k rows. The Ledgerly export worker loads the full workbook into memory; large exports can hit the 4 GB pod limit and get OOM-killed. Workaround: ask the customer to export per-tab, or bump the worker tier via the admin panel. If the crash persists on a small sheet, file a defect and attach the export job's trace token shown below.

build token for kagaf-hahof: htk14_9d3d4d26d7d8de

Management Meeting Minutes — Gross-Margin Review

Present: Delia Fonseca (chair), Ros Tiverton, Ames Kellard. Apologies: none.

Delia walked the new director through Q2 margins — down two points, mostly the Larkhall contract and freight creep on the Osmund line. Ros thinks we can claw back a point by renegotiating with Bellwick Haulage; Ames is less sure. Agreed: reprice the Osmund range next month and hold the Larkhall rate until renewal. Actions logged in the tracker. The thinking behind the reprice is set out in the note below.

board note of bajop-yaweg: The western region missed its Pelys quota by 58.0 percent last quarter. Pelysek Foods plans to raise the Belius list price by 44.0 percent in July. The steering committee signed off on a budget of $133.8 million for Project Pelax. The renewal with Zoraelix Systems closes at $61.9 million a year, 12.7 percent above the last contract.

## Notes — Gateway Rate Limiting Review

We walked through the new per-tenant limits on the Copperline internal gateway. Key points for support: limits now apply per token, not per team, so a tenant with several tokens may see uneven throttling. The 429 responses include a retry-after header that support should quote verbatim rather than estimating. Burst allowances reset hourly, not daily — this changed last sprint and older docs are wrong. Any limit-raise request must be escalated for sign-off to the engineer named below.

account owner for bawip-tahag: Raleth Quenok